Abstract

A plastics zip for clothing has two mutually engagable male ( 203 ) and female ( 204 ) zip profiles of generally uniform cross section along the whole or part of their length and merged or demerged within a special slider ( 115 ). The slider has two guide slots ( 116, 117 ) which join to create a Y-shaped passageway within the body of the slider and side slits ( 118, 119 ) to allow the slider to move along the fixed tapes or flanges ( 108, 109 ) of the zip profiles. One of the guide slots contains an expansion element ( 226 ) which opens the jaws of the female profile allowing it pass over and capture the smaller male profile so that the zip is merged. Movement of the slider in the opposite direction allows the two profiles to be demerged and exit from the slider.

Claims

exact text as granted — not AI-modified
1 . A zip for use on garments, clothing, bags, safety wear and sports equipment, said zip comprising two mutually engagable zip tracks, each track attached to or integral with a tape, and a slider capable of moving along the zip tracks to merge or demerge the tracks, wherein a first of said zip tracks has a female profile defining a cavity with the slot extending along the length of the zip; and a second of said zip tracks has a male profile capable of fitting within and being retained by the female profile; and wherein the slider has guide means within the slider adapted to guide the male and female profiles towards one another for merging to allow the female profile to fit over and capture the male profile so that the two tracks are merged together into a closed state.  
   
   
       2 . A zip as claimed in  claim 1 , wherein guide means includes an expansion element adapted to open the slot of the female profile sufficiently to allow the female profile to fit over and capture the male profile so that the two tracks are merged together into a closed state.  
   
   
       3 . A zip as claimed in  claim 1 , wherein the male profile is generally wedge shaped in cross section having an apex and a base, with a tape or flange attached to or forming part of the base thereof, and the female profile is of a complementary wedge shape in cross section having an apex and a base, with a slot along the base of the female wedge shape and a tape or flange attached to or forming part of the apex of the female wedge shape and wherein the guide means within the slider has an entrance end and an exit end and includes a male slot having an entrance aperture at the entrance end of the slider and adapted to allow passage of the male profile therethrough, and a female slot an entrance aperture at the entrance end of the slider and adapted to allow passage of the female profile therethrough, the male and female slots extending from the entrance end of the slider towards one another and towards a merged slot which terminates at an exit aperture in the exit end of the slider and wherein the male profile is adapted to penetrate and open the slot of the female member within the slider to allow the female profile to fit over and capture the male profile so that the two tracks are merged together into a closed state.  
   
   
       4 . A zip as claimed in  claim 2 , wherein the male profile is of generally uniform cross section along the whole or a substantial part of its length.  
   
   
       5 . A zip as claimed in  claim 2 , wherein the female profile is of generally uniform cross section along the whole or a substantial part of its length.  
   
   
       6 . A zip as claimed in  claim 2 , wherein the guide means within the slider has an entrance end and an exit end and includes a male slot having an entrance aperture at the entrance end of the slider and adapted to allow passage of the male profile therethrough, and a female slot an entrance aperture at the entrance end of the slider and adapted to allow passage of the female profile therethrough, the male and female slots extending from the entrance end of the slider towards one another and towards a merged slot which terminates at an exit aperture in the exit end of the slider.  
   
   
       7 . A zip as claimed in  claim 6 , wherein the slots within the slider are combined into a generally “Y” shape where the male and female slots combine to form the merged slot.  
   
   
       8 . A zip as claimed in  claim 7 , wherein the male and female profiles have tapes extending from opposite edges thereof for connection to a garment or other substrate, and the slots within the slider have side slits to allow the slider to move along the tapes of the zip profiles.  
   
   
       9 . A zip as claimed in  claim 8 , wherein the expansion element is located in the female slot and has a tapered portion facing towards the entrance end so that it can be located in the cavity of the female profile.  
   
   
       10 . A zip as claimed in  claim 9 , wherein the expansion element in the female slot is of a tapered nature extending from its widest point at or near the merged slot, to a narrow end facing towards the entrance aperture of the female slot.  
   
   
       11 . A slider for a zip of the type claimed in  claim 1 , wherein the slider has guide means within the slider adapted to guide male and female zip profiles towards one another for merging, and an expansion element within said slider adapted to open the slot of the female zip profile sufficiently to allow the female zip profile to fit over and capture the male zip profile so that the two tracks are merged together into a closed state.
